Synopsis
In the 2018 film Nyitva, audiences are invited into the intimate yet chaotic world of a modern couple navigating the complexities of non-monogamy. With a witty blend of comedy, drama, and romance, the story centers around Anna and Mark, whose relationship morphs as they explore the boundaries of love and attraction. This relationship dramedy artfully captures the exhilarating highs and uncomfortable lows of opening up their partnership, revealing not only the thrill of new connections but also the insecurities and challenges that arise when the rules of love are rewritten.
The film delves into themes of trust, communication, and personal growth, portraying the characters' journey with a refreshing honesty that resonates with anyone who has ever questioned the traditional norms of relationships. As Anna and Mark encounter a vibrant cast of characters—each with their own perspectives on love and commitment—viewers are treated to a rich tapestry of experiences that provoke both laughter and introspection. With its relatable humor and poignant moments, Nyitva invites the audience to reflect on the nature of intimacy, making it a thoughtful choice for anyone curious about the evolving landscape of modern relationships.
